From 5ea649cc3b1767acc42658610cfacbc1f77e24cc Mon Sep 17 00:00:00 2001 From: rusefillc Date: Sun, 27 Nov 2022 09:50:26 -0500 Subject: [PATCH] minor usability whistle --- .../src/main/java/com/rusefi/core/rusEFIVersion.java | 2 +- .../ui/src/main/java/com/rusefi/maintenance/DfuFlasher.java | 1 + java_console/ui/src/main/java/com/rusefi/ui/StatusWindow.java | 4 ++++ 3 files changed, 6 insertions(+), 1 deletion(-) diff --git a/java_console/shared_io/src/main/java/com/rusefi/core/rusEFIVersion.java b/java_console/shared_io/src/main/java/com/rusefi/core/rusEFIVersion.java index beb06c6ba3..90b9b031b1 100644 --- a/java_console/shared_io/src/main/java/com/rusefi/core/rusEFIVersion.java +++ b/java_console/shared_io/src/main/java/com/rusefi/core/rusEFIVersion.java @@ -6,7 +6,7 @@ import java.net.URL; import java.util.concurrent.atomic.AtomicReference; public class rusEFIVersion { - public static final int CONSOLE_VERSION = 20221111; + public static final int CONSOLE_VERSION = 20221127; public static AtomicReference firmwareVersion = new AtomicReference<>("N/A"); public static long classBuildTimeMillis() { diff --git a/java_console/ui/src/main/java/com/rusefi/maintenance/DfuFlasher.java b/java_console/ui/src/main/java/com/rusefi/maintenance/DfuFlasher.java index 36403e6419..99f8c99e83 100644 --- a/java_console/ui/src/main/java/com/rusefi/maintenance/DfuFlasher.java +++ b/java_console/ui/src/main/java/com/rusefi/maintenance/DfuFlasher.java @@ -155,6 +155,7 @@ public class DfuFlasher { // looks like sometimes we are not catching the last line of the response? 'Upgrade' happens before 'Verify' wnd.append("SUCCESS!"); wnd.append("Please power cycle device to exit DFU mode"); + wnd.setSuccessState(); } else if (stdout.toString().contains("Target device not found")) { wnd.append("ERROR: Device not connected or STM32 Bootloader driver not installed?"); appendWindowsVersion(wnd); diff --git a/java_console/ui/src/main/java/com/rusefi/ui/StatusWindow.java b/java_console/ui/src/main/java/com/rusefi/ui/StatusWindow.java index e3dbcf0aba..45f0907e48 100644 --- a/java_console/ui/src/main/java/com/rusefi/ui/StatusWindow.java +++ b/java_console/ui/src/main/java/com/rusefi/ui/StatusWindow.java @@ -60,6 +60,10 @@ public class StatusWindow implements StatusConsumer { copyContentToClipboard(); } + public void setSuccessState() { + logTextArea.setBackground(LIGHT_GREEN); + } + public JFrame getFrame() { return frameHelper.getFrame(); }